#4d8642 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d8642 is composed of 30.2% red, 52.5%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.7%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 110.3 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 39.2%. #4d8642 color hex could be obtained by blending #9aff84 with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#4d8642

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f5fa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d8642

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626761 is the less saturated color, while #23c404 is the most saturated one.
